Transaction 78f61f0577ae5a0f20cf81d42907f16960162462ca554b7cd827609a5b015838
3 Input
2 Outputs
- 78f61f0577ae5a0f20cf81d42907f16960162462ca554b7cd827609a5b015838:0
- 78f61f0577ae5a0f20cf81d42907f16960162462ca554b7cd827609a5b015838:1
value 907071
address 1HDDAqWMX2ZKaqU88kpfrd3HEJodJCTWjq
value 57100000
address 19Mj3XBDgr5NbFYD2NL6WCExgxnY938jwb